 Shot the starring role in the film "Lily's Hope." Lily, a young girl growing up in China, is sent to America in the hopes of going to medical school and realizing her dreams of becoming a doctor. Her dreams are quickly shattered when she realizes her "family friend" had tricked all of them and sold her into a human trafficking ring.

This was perhaps the most challenging project I've worked on so far, and a very wonderful experience. The film was shot over several weekends and is in Mandarin Chinese. The footage so far looks great, I can't wait to see the finished product & have some clips for my reel!
